Meet Melissa Michaels of Inpeloto in La Jolla

Today we’d like to introduce you to Melissa Michaels.

Thanks for sharing your story with us Melissa. So, let’s start at the beginning, and we can move on from there.
I’m a creative, an award-winning author, former model and producer. I decided to make products that would remind people of INfinite PEace LOve and TOgetherness = Inpeloto. I started with jewelry, making silver signature pieces with all things INfinite, PEace, LOve and TOgetherness. Then designing t-shirts happened and continued with creating t-shirt bags.

Because of the plastic bag ban in California and Hawaii, I provide an alternative to plastic bags. My t-shirt bags are multi-functional. You can use them at the grocery store, throw your yoga gear or beach towels in them. They have a boho chic vibe. Each color represents an element of Inpeloto. The crystals I use are representative of infinity, peace, love, and togetherness. It’s all energy and consciousness.

So, as you know, we’re impressed with Inpeloto – tell our readers more, for example, what you’re most proud of as a company and what sets you apart from others.
Inpeloto is a socially conscious brand consisting of artistic expressions in the form of eco-friendly jewelry, accessories, and clothing.

Inpeloto comprises of handcrafted jewelry line called Inpeloto Bella, Jewelry with Conscience™ which integrates a love of poetry into the designs. Inpeloto BodyWear Clothing with Conscience™ is limited edition t-shirts with universal positive symbolic graphics, socially conscious messages for men and women, along with t-shirt bags.

I created a word for my company, and it is intentionally woven throughout my designs. I make everything in my brand. My brand has purpose.
